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2002.08.19;
Скачать: CL | DM;

Вниз

Создание триггера в InterBase=проблема   Найти похожие ветки 

 
bobr12   (2002-07-30 12:06) [0]

Пытаюсь создать триггер для занесения в ключевой столбец уникальных значений (так как InterBase не поддерживает автоинкрементные поля). Делаю следующие действия (как в книжке)
1. Создаю таблицу:
CREATE TABLE GRUPPA
(
CODE INTEGER NOT NULL,
GRUPPA VARCHAR(10) NOT NULL,
PRIMARY KEY (CODE)
);

2.Создаю генерератор:
CREATE GENERATOR GENGRUPPA;
SET GENERATOR GENGRUPPA TO 1;
Все идет нормально - генератор и таблица создаются

3.Пытаюсь Cоздать Триггер
CREATE TRIGGER CodeGruppa FOR GRUPPA
ACTIVE
BEFORE INSERT
AS
BEGIN
NEW.Code=GEN_ID(GenGruppa,1);
END
И начинается ругань: Unexpected end of command. В чем же здесь проблема? - Все повторяю как в книжке написано.


 
3JIA9I CyKA ©   (2002-07-30 12:08) [1]


SET TERM ^;

CREATE TRIGGER CodeGruppa FOR GRUPPA
ACTIVE
BEFORE INSERT
AS
BEGIN
NEW.Code=GEN_ID(GenGruppa,1);
END

SET TERM ;^



Страницы: 1 вся ветка

Текущий архив: 2002.08.19;
Скачать: CL | DM;

Наверх




Память: 0.46 MB
Время: 0.015 c
3-60485
vich
2002-07-25 02:28
2002.08.19
Пытаюсь сравнить дату из базы с системной и выдать сообщение.


4-60906
NetAmigo
2002-06-15 03:25
2002.08.19
как в Delphi создать кнопку, при нажатии на которую, запускалась


7-60864
Dmitry V. Averuanov
2002-05-11 12:06
2002.08.19
В какой каталог установлен Windows


7-60882
Oleg_er
2002-06-03 15:33
2002.08.19
Кто использует файл на серваке?


14-60853
jen_bond
2002-07-23 11:27
2002.08.19
Помогите с сылкой